There are four days left until the Big East showdown at high noon on Saturday to crown the regular season champion. For the next four days we at Hoya Hoops will be getting everybody ready for what can easily be classified as the most important Georgetown game in the history of the Verizon Center.

As part of our four days of buildup, we will also be paying homage to the four Georgetown seniors who will be playing for the final time in front of the home crowd at Verizon Center - a crowd which has grown and improved as much as the program has over the past four seasons. Including their most recent dramatic victory against Marquette, the seniors have combined to do so much for the program:

  • They have scored 3,054 Points
  • Grabbed 1,375 Rebounds
  • Dished Out 639 Assists
  • And Earned 96 Wins.

We will begin our tribute with the 6′4″ guard from Stuarts Draft, VA - Tyler Crawford. Be sure to check back later to see what we have to say about Bam Bam.
